89-91 points/'Outstanding,' Allen Meadows (Burghound): "(60% from Les Grasses Têtes and the remainder from Le Grand Poirier). A very pretty nose features notes of various dark berries, plum, violet and a whiff of newly turned earth. The succulent, round and delicious middle weight flavors possess a caressing mouthfeel that contrasts moderately with the firm, serious and mildly rustic finale. This is quite dense in the context of the vintage and this is worth checking out. Drink: 2029+. (Jan 2025)"
